her
hair all Prell and Aqua Net
mine all Brylcreem
gives away our ages
but not our amour
I asked her out to dinner
she said why don't I cook something
in
I showed up at her door
with gathered wild flowers
and a bottle of Chardonnay
she cooked my favorite dinner
Spaghetti and garlic bread
and we watched
Breakfast at Tiffany's
until I fell asleep next to her on the couch
snoring
I thought it sweet she covered me up
and left a wildflower
from her bouquet on my pillow
we may  be old and the vigor dimmed
but we are still romantics
deep down
within.
